Creating a new webinar funnel
Navigate to Sites > Webinars
Click Sites in the left sidebar, then select Webinars. Click New Webinar Funnel.
Choose live or on-demand
Select the webinar type:
- Live — for a scheduled, real-time session
- On-Demand — for a pre-recorded video that plays automatically on registration
Name the funnel
Enter a name for the webinar funnel. This is an internal label — it will not be shown to registrants unless you use it as the webinar title on the registration page.
Building the registration page
The registration page is the entry point for your webinar. It must capture attendee contact information and create excitement for the event.Open the registration page in the builder
In the webinar funnel, click on the registration page step to open the drag-and-drop editor.
Add a form element
Drag a Form element onto the page. Configure the form to collect at minimum:
- First name — personalizes reminder emails
- Email address — required for sending confirmation and reminder emails
Customize the page content
Add content that answers the key questions every prospective attendee has:
- What is this webinar about? — a clear, benefit-focused headline
- Who is presenting? — presenter name and a brief credibility statement
- When is it? — date, time, and time zone displayed prominently
- What will I learn or gain? — 3–5 bullet points listing specific outcomes
- How long is it? — set expectations for the time commitment
Set the form submit action
Configure what happens after a visitor submits the form. Typically, the form redirect takes registrants to the webinar room page (for on-demand) or to a confirmation page (for live webinars).
Configuring the webinar schedule
For live webinars, the session date and time must be configured so that reminders are sent at the right moments.Open the webinar funnel Actions menu
From the Webinars list, click the three-dot icon on the funnel and select Edit, or open the funnel and navigate to its settings.
Set the session date and time
Enter the scheduled date and start time for the webinar. Select the time zone. For recurring webinars (weekly, monthly), set the recurrence schedule.
Setting up the on-demand video
For on-demand webinars, the pre-recorded video is configured in the webinar room page.Configure the video source
In the webinar room settings, add the video. Accepted sources:
- YouTube — paste the video URL (use an unlisted video to prevent public discovery)
- Vimeo — paste the Vimeo video URL
- Hosted video — upload or link to a video file in your Media Library
Set the video start behavior
Configure whether the video starts playing immediately when the registrant arrives, plays after a brief countdown, or starts at a specific point in the recording.
Activating automation recipes
Webinar Recipes are pre-built automation templates for the standard webinar email sequence. Activate them from the funnel settings.Navigate to Recipes
Find the Recipes section in the funnel settings. You will see the available Webinar Recipes: registration confirmation, 24-hour reminder, 1-hour reminder, and post-event replay.
Activate each recipe
Toggle each recipe on. Review and customize the email content for each one — especially the subject lines, sender name, and any personal details about the webinar.
Publishing and sharing the webinar
Connect a domain
Connect a domain or subdomain to the webinar funnel in the funnel’s Settings tab. The registration page will be accessible at this URL.
